Output 39311824d4bf814ffc71c2841181acdef7e2fc8d4f6209b4704209557890e428:7

value
49621075
script pubkey
OP_0 OP_PUSHBYTES_20 0d51626679fdc865464ede47fff6faae98115450
address
ltc1qp4gkyenelhyx23jwmerllah646vpz4zsma6rzw
transaction
39311824d4bf814ffc71c2841181acdef7e2fc8d4f6209b4704209557890e428
spent
true